Authenticator is a shared component which encapsulates authentication services required by OHDSI tools. Its goal is to reduce amount of effort required to implement and support authentication in multiple applications, provide single source of truth.
Currently supported modes:
- Standard
- Proxy
Currently supported methods:
- Database (JDBC)
- REST
- Github
- LDAP
- Active Directory
The proxy mode means that your application is deployed on an environment behind a proxy. This proxy takes full responsibility for the authentication, and transfer to us only an access token in a request header. This mode is currently implemented for IAP(Identity-Aware Proxy) https://cloud.google.com/iap/

The standard authentication mode means that your application takes care of the authentication process by itself.
The STANDARD
authentication mode is the default mode, so it is not necessary to explicitly configure it.

Authentication across directory requires special system account that is used to conduct search.
searchFilter
is a formatted LDAP query used to authenticate user. Query should include at least a parameter for
user who is logging in. Formatted parameters should be encoded to fit MessageFormat.format
.
Query example: uid={0}
. For succesful authentication searchFilter
must return exactly one record.
When a single record is found, authentication service will try to bind to directory using distinguished name of result node and
provided password.
url
defines server URL including protocol and port, e.g. ldap://localhost:389
userDn
Distinguished name of system account having permissions to search across directory
password
Password of the account
baseDn
Distingueshed name of the top level tree node that gives subtree to search across
countLimit
reduces count limit of search results, default is 0 meaning no restrictions
ignorePartialResultException
when set to true partial result exceptions are ignored, this is useful when
searching on forest, multi-domain or multi-node directories
searchFilter
LDAP query that should return desired user node, authentication fails when the query returns no records
